I hate to rain on everyone's parade, but I have some issues with the claims of who this person is for several reasons:

As a former Marine, this guy is completely out of regulations, not just in small ways, but in really huge NASTY ways. NO self-respecting active duty Marine would dare go in public looking like this. It's my opinion that he borrowed a friend's uniform without their knowledge. There's nothing that would convince me he is either an active duty Marine or even a recently former Marine. NO WAY...
a.) No cammies are allowed to be worn in public off base....period.
b.) He's unshaven.
c.) He's not wearing his cover.
d.) His blouse is not only unbuttoned, but it's clearly too small.
e.) His sleeves aren't rolled properly.
f.) His green t-shirt is untucked.
g.) He is inciting a riot....IN UNIFORM AND ON CAMERA!!! HELLO!! NO military service member is allowed
to go on camera in uniform and speak with any sort of political overtones AT ALL.
h.) He's sporting ribbons on his unbuttoned cammie blouse...ribbons are not authorized for use on cammies,
and even if they were, he's wearing them improperly.

If by some off chance he IS a former Marine, he shames his Corps by the fact that he appeared so sloppily and attempted to speak on behalf of the Marine Corps, which he would never be allowed to do as an active duty Marine.
